KOHAT Two houses close to the heavily guarded imambargah in the city were damaged in rocket attacks by militants on Wednesday night.
The rockets fired from the western side of the city exploded at the roofs of two houses close to the Said Habib Imambargah. The police said the target was the imambargah which was slightly missed. The bomb disposal squad said the rockets were Russain made multi-barrel 107 MM.
The residents of the houses remained unhurt however the boundary walls and roofs of the houses were damaged.
High police officials and ambulances reached the scene to collect evidence and start investigation.
The blasts caused immense fear among people in the neighbourhood.
